How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Central Office?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Central Office Studio Apartments | $1,271 | $844 | $2,409 |
| Central Office 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,499 | $852 | $2,505 |
| Central Office 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,855 | $1,020 | $3,795 |
| Central Office 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,117 | $920 | $3,508 |
| Central Office 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,210 | $1,150 | $1,620 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Central Office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Central Office?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Central Office is at Chesterfield Apartments listed at $815.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Central Office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Central Office is $1,754.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Central Office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Central Office is a 4,043 square feet unit starting from $1,317 at Pohlig Box Factory Apartments.
What is the average size for Central Office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Central Office is currently at 601 sq ft.
